Not an Ordinary Life
It was a fair Saturday afternoon and Livia had to prepare for her part-time job at Cafe Wheels. She was a bit worried because she did not have enough time to iron her clothes and she would have another encounter with her boss who never fails to nag at her. It's ten minutes to three o'clock in the afternoon, her biometrics showed as she logged in at the cafe. Livia thanked God that she made it despite the heavy traffic. It's September and many tourists are coming to their city as it is one of the best places to be in their country - cool breeze, amazing mountain views, great artists, good food, cafes and bars all over. These are just some of the things the tourists come here for. "Livia...," a tall handsome man with a fair built said to her. His eyebrows are again touching each other conveying a disappointed look. "What did I tell you about uniforms? You just don't listen, do you?" "Mr. Brooks... Oh, I'm sorry... I didn't have enough time to...", she was not yet finished speaking when Mr. Brooks turned around without even listening to her explanation. What is about her uniform that he can't stand?  "It's just a uniform...", she whispered as she went to the counter and started the day's work.  "Hey, don't mind him." Another tall guy appeared patting her shoulder. "Oh, Josh. I didn't notice you there. I just don't get why he can't see anything nice. Just my uniform." "Well, you can make it up next time. Think about it, you have tomorrow to prove that he's wrong... Whatever he's thinking..." he said while smiling. Livia felt comforted and was glad there are people like Josh who could pull up the mood. Now she can start working without a heavy heart. She smiled to the customers heading her way and greeted them with buoyancy. Thanks to Josh, she was powered up with his comforting words and retained her energy even after seven o'clock. While she was walking home, Livia was contemplating if she would ever have a chance to improve the kind of life that she has. Will there be anything more from this ordinary routine? She has only three places significant in her life now - work, home, and school. If only her dad didn't die early. Maybe she wouldn't feel as bad as she feels. She will be turning twenty a few months from now but she hasn't enjoyed her life as her classmates are enjoying. She had to toil for her schooling since her dad died... "Sweetie, what do you want to be when you grow up?" she can still remember her dad asking her when she was seven years younger. "Dad, I want to be like you. A dashing lawyer who defends the rights of others!" she recalls her answer. That seemed impossible now since she had to take a scholarship in Math to continue studying. Mathematics was not her first choice but because of the scholarship, she had to grab the opportunity. Now that she's in her junior year, her subjects are getting more difficult as they delve into calculus and mathematical models. "What was I thinking? How can I go through this?" Many times she wanted to give up but her desire for a better life kept her hanging. She decided to live her life one step at a time as she hurdles to the finish line.   Passing by a park, she saw two love birds, tightly holding each others' hands while sweetly talking to each other. "Oh, come on..." Livia whispered as she got near them. How can these people waste their time doing crazy things? Is it just me or... She realized that she's getting bitter. She hadn't had the chance to fall in love considering her circumstance. Well, what else could she expect. Her time is not even enough to do homework, the chores at home, and even her time for work. She doesn't even know what is that love they are calling. She hasn't even felt it... Or was she just ignoring it? Not my cup of tea... She thought as she entered their house and prepared for the next day.
